UH-1B 62-12537 (c/n 688) was retired to MASDC, Davis-Monthan AFB, AZ, Sep 2 1975, and placed on the Army storage inventory with code XA068. It departed Mar 23 1977, for san Bernardino City, Rialto, CA.

Unless it has hitherto unheard of 'inaccuracies', Jos Stevens 'Rotorspot-B205 production list' has the ultimate built B205A-1 as sn 30332.
The latest sn D-reg (Agrarflug) 205 was 30318.It was followed by 14 built for the Philippines.
